본문 바로가기

프로그래머스467

[프로그래머스 / SQL] 재구매가 일어난 상품과 회원 리스트 구하기 -CodeSELECT DISTINCT USER_ID, PRODUCT_IDFROM ONLINE_SALEGROUP BY USER_ID, PRODUCT_IDHAVING COUNT(*) > 1ORDER BY USER_ID, PRODUCT_ID DESC; 2025. 7. 12.
[프로그래머스 / SQL] 특정 물고기를 잡은 총 수 구하기 -CodeSELECT COUNT(*) AS FISH_COUNTFROM FISH_INFO AS FI JOIN FISH_NAME_INFO AS FNI ON FI.FISH_TYPE = FNI.FISH_TYPEWHERE FNI.FISH_NAME IN ('BASS', 'SNAPPER'); 2025. 7. 11.
[프로그래머스 / SQL] 3월에 태어난 여성 회원 목록 출력하기 -CodeSELECT MEMBER_ID, MEMBER_NAME, GENDER, DATE_FORMAT(DATE_OF_BIRTH, '%Y-%m-%d') AS DATE_OF_BIRTHFROM MEMBER_PROFILE WHERE MONTH(DATE_OF_BIRTH) = 3 AND GENDER = 'W' AND TLNO IS NOT NULLORDER BY MEMBER_ID ASC; 2025. 7. 11.
[프로그래머스 / SQL] 조건에 맞는 도서와 저자 리스트 출력하기 -CodeSELECT BOOK_ID, AUTHOR_NAME, DATE_FORMAT(PUBLISHED_DATE, '%Y-%m-%d') AS PUBLISHED_DATEFROM BOOK AS B JOIN AUTHOR AS A ON B.AUTHOR_ID = A.AUTHOR_IDWHERE B.CATEGORY = '경제'ORDER BY PUBLISHED_DATE; 2025. 7. 11.
[프로그래머스 / SQL] 업그레이드 된 아이템 구하기 -Code SELECT II.ITEM_ID, ITEM_NAME, RARITYFROM ITEM_INFO AS II JOIN ITEM_TREE AS IT ON II.ITEM_ID = IT.ITEM_IDWHERE IT.PARENT_ITEM_ID IN ( SELECT ITEM_ID FROM ITEM_INFO WHERE RARITY = 'RARE' )ORDER BY ITEM_ID DESC; 2025. 7. 10.
[프로그래머스 / SQL] DATETIME에서 DATE로 형 변환 -CodeSELECT ANIMAL_ID, NAME, DATE_FORMAT(DATETIME, '%Y-%m-%d')FROM ANIMAL_INS; 2025. 7. 10.